Procurement of logging and sales of timber
Reference number: 22/45202The aim of the contract is to increase the value creation for the forestry industry in Oslo municipality.
The aim of the procurement is twofold. Firstly, the procurement concerns a service for logging of forests owned by Oslo municipality. BYM is dependent on the best contractors on the market to be able to adapt to working in and developing multi-layered forests and to be able to harvest in rough terrain while making the least amount of tracks possible.
Secondly, the procurement concerns a service for the sale of timber. Sales of timber includes both timber harvested by the contractor as well as timber harvested by BYM.
The procurement will ensure that Oslo municipality can maintain active and sustainable forestry, which also serves outdoor recreation and biodiversity in Oslo municipality.
Oslo municipality, c/o the Agency for Urban Environment (Norwegian: BYM), invites tenderers to an open tender contest in connection with the delivery of logging and sales of timber.
The contracting authority has an option to extend the contract on the same terms for a further two plus two years, (2+2). The option is automatically exercised unless the contracting authority notifies in writing before the end of the contract that the option will not be exercised.

Requirement: Tenderers must be a legally established company.
• Documentation Requirement: Norwegian tenderers: Company Registration Certificate
Foreign tenderers: Verification that the company is registered in a trade index or a register of business enterprises as prescribed by the law of the country where the company is established.
Requirement: Tenderers must have sufficient financial capacity to fulfil the contract.
Documentation requirement: Credit assessment/rating equivalent to "A" in the AAA-rating system, not older than 6 months, and which is based on the last known accounting figures.
Requirement: Tenderers must have sufficient experience from equivalent assignments, which must include logging, including thinning, and sales of timber.
Documentation requirement: An overview showing the tenderer"s executed assignments for the last five years, including the values, dates, recipients and the nature and scope of the work. (See annex 6).
Requirement: Environment management measures must have been established, which ensure that the tenderer is suitable to comply with the contractual obligations for environmental regulations. This means that the tenderer must have methods for working actively and systematically on reducing negative environmental impact from the tenderer activities related to the implementation of this contract.
Documentation requirement: If the tenderer is certified, certification in accordance with ISO 14001 with the Norwegian PEFC Forest Standard or equivalent, a certificate issued by other bodies in other EEA states as documentation that the requirement is fulfilled.
If the tenderer is not certified: A description of the tenderer"s environmental management measures, including a description of environmental policy, climate and environmental goals, conformity assessments and measures and procedures with continual improvement measures.
Requirement: Tenderers must have a quality assurance system.
Documentation requirement: If the tenderer is not certified: An account of the tenderer"s quality assurance measures. The account must include a short description of routines and methods for execution, internal control and documentation for field work.
If a tenderer is certified, a copy of a certificate issued by the certification body shall be submitted. The tenderer can then disregard the documentation requirement above, e.g. ISO 9001:2008 or equivalent.
